Fax on Demand 202/418-2830 Internet: http:/www.fcc.gov FTP site: ftp.fcc.gov DA 98-575 Released: March 25, 1998 COMMON CARRIER BUREAU SEEKS COMMENT ON SBC COMPANIES' PETITION FOR EXTENSION OF TIME OF THE LOCAL NUMBER PORTABILITY PHASE II IMPLEMENTATION DEADLINE CC Docket 95-116 NSD File No. L-98-16 Comment Date: April 3, 1998 Reply Comment Date: April 9, 1998 On February 20, 1998, Southwestern Bell Telephone Company (SWBT) and Pacific Bell (Pacific) (collectively the SBC Companies) filed a petition seeking an extension of time of the May 15, 1998, Local Number Portability ("LNP") Phase II implementation deadline. SBC Companies request delay in the implementation schedule to address defects found in Signal Transfer Points (STP) software supplied by a vendor. SBC states that the STP defects were not discovered until January 21, 1998, after live production testing was underway. We seek comments on SBC Companies' Petition for Extension of the May 15, 1998, Phase II Implementation deadline. If parties have already commented on SBC Companies' petitions, and have addressed scheduling delays beyond Phase I implementation in their comments, those parties need not file additional comments specifically addressing delays of Phase II implementation. Comments are due by April 3, 1998, and reply comments by April 9, 1998. Ex parte presentations in this proceeding will be governed by the procedures set forth in Section 1.1206 of the Commission's rules, that are applicable to "permit- but-disclose" proceedings.
